How Ameal Brooks's Games Played as Fielder Compares to Similar Players
Ameal Brooks totaled 211 career Games Played as Fielder, well above the league average of 109.8 — a mark that ranked among the best of his era. His best Games Played as Fielder season came in 1943, posting 35. The lowest point came in 1929 at 1. Output was consistent through the final seasons. The Games Played as Fielder total went from 3 in 1945 to 6 in 1946 and 2 in 1947, falling over the span. The consistent output characterized his final seasons. Significant season-to-season variance characterizes the Games Played as Fielder profile — ranging from 1 to 35 — though the career average remained well above league norms.
